Which model number is your Audigy? There are quite a few different Audigy models, including ones that don't have an EMU chip. I have a SB0570 here that has the same behavior, but it's an "Audigy SE/LE" with a different chip (CA0106) and IIRC even the Linux driver has some issues with output volume / quality (on Linux, I was able to get it kind-of working [with some issues] when disabling SPDIF in alsamixer).
